- The plant cell has a cell wall, a rigid outer layer that provides support and protection for the cell.
- Inside the cell wall is the cell membrane, a semi-permeable barrier that controls what enters and leaves the cell.
- The plant cell also contains a large central vacuole, which stores water, nutrients, and waste products.
- The cytoplasm is the jelly-like substance that fills the cell and contains the organelles.
- The nucleus houses the cell's genetic material and controls the cell's activities.
- Other organelles found in plant cells include chloroplasts, which are responsible for photosynthesis, and mitochondria, which generate energy for the cell.
